I was going to be at the games anyways,” Clarke said. “My daughter is on the team and she’s a senior this year. Logan runs the practices on the girls side while Clarke coaches the matches. Former Pensacola Catholic head coach Del Greatwood along with Ryan Carty and Bedo Elbaioumy serve as assistant coaches for the boys team while Gulf Coast Texans coach Dean Logan contributes to the girls team. Without the adequate time to find a replacement, Clarke took on the responsibility of coaching both squads. Keith Little resigned as the Jaguars girls head coach just prior to the start of the season. That stretch is even more impressive considering that Clarke is splitting his time guiding the school’s boys and girls soccer teams.
